To help prevent scammers who like to get on here I think it would be best from now on, if people want to sell coins or accounts, to list the account #'s so we can look at them before buying. It would also be good to have screen shots of your wallet ready to prove your holdings. And as always it's best to do small test transactions first to verify you receive your Pascal before sending anyone more BTC.

Hi everyone,
I would like to warn you to be very cautious if you want to trade with user Opentalklab, use an escrow only!
I don't claim he's a scammer because I have no proof about it, but his behavior has been very suspicious to me.
Mind you, he's clever in his way to proceed, but that's what you would expect from a good scammer!

First, you can notice there's a previous message in this very thread from a shilling account(?) from a user with a bad reputation, claiming that you can trust OpentalkLab, because he sent first and received his coins, 15k.

So I contacted OpentalkLab, and he claims he has 50k to sell, that means he would have mined at least 65k (50k + 15 k) coins from September 27th, where he claimed he just installed the wallet. Notice he never posted mining issues, but has a few to make the wallet working. What are the chances he mined so much in 19 days?

Anyway, I asked him to use escrow, which he agreed first, but then he replied "I have no problem with escrow. Just don't want to waste time." As soon as I've sent the PM to escrow (which I used previously for another trade) and him in the same time for preparing the deal, he replied that he had "found someone and your escrow is still offline. If you don't want to first, I am selling to him." I replied I won't sent 1.75 btc like that and increments would take even more time than waiting for the escrow, I have no reply since...

I would add that I have dealt PascalCoins successfully with 3 persons here without problems (one I sent first, one he sent first, and one escrowed).
